About 01 Numbers
These digits are linked with specific locations in the UK and are frequently used by residential and commercial properties. Frequently termed as 'basic rate', 'local rate', or 'national rate' numbers, the charges for these geographic numbers are contingent on the time of day. A good number of service providers offer call packages that offer free calls during particular times. Call costs from mobile phones are dependent on the chosen calling plan, with many plans providing these numbers in their free call packages.
